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S) is the unexplained death of a seemingly healthy infant who is younger than one year. In the United States, SIDS is the major cause of death in infants from one…

The Driving Under the Influence (DUI) programs are State mandated programs, following conviction for DUI. The objective of the DUI program is to reduce the number of repeat DUI offenses by completing…

California voters approved Proposition 36 on November 7th, 2000. This is known as the Substance Abuse and Crime Prevention Act (SACPA) of 2000. Under SACPA and Penal Code 1210.1 (PC1210), first or…
